How much does a Credit Representative make?

The average salary for a Credit Representative is $49,136 per year in the US.

A Credit Representative plays a key role in the financial industry. They assess the creditworthiness of individuals and businesses. This job often involves reviewing financial documents and making decisions about loan approvals. The average yearly salary for a Credit Representative is $49,136. This figure can vary based on experience, location, and the specific employer.

The salary range for Credit Representatives can be quite broad. At the lower end, some may earn around $31,500. As experience grows, salaries can climb to over $100,000. Factors like education, industry, and company size can also influence earnings. For example, those in urban areas or with advanced degrees may see higher pay. Additionally, those in larger companies often earn more than those in smaller firms.

What are the highest paying cities for a Credit Representative?

Credit Representatives can find some of the best pay in Tampa, FL, where the average salary reaches $49,682. Houston, TX, offers a competitive average salary of $48,492 for these professionals. Las Vegas, NV, Fargo, ND, and Sioux Falls, SD, also provide attractive salaries, with averages around $43,692, $41,500, and $41,500, respectively. How to earn more as a Credit Representative?

A Credit Representative can increase their earnings through various strategies. Building strong relationships with clients and understanding their financial situations can lead to better credit terms. This understanding allows for more effective negotiations, which can result in higher commissions and bonuses. Additionally, gaining certifications in credit management can enhance skills and credibility, making it easier to secure higher-paying positions.

Continuous learning and staying updated with industry trends also play a crucial role. Attending workshops, seminars, and obtaining advanced degrees in finance or business can open doors to better opportunities. Networking with other professionals in the industry can lead to referrals and job openings that offer higher salaries. Lastly, demonstrating a strong work ethic and achieving high performance metrics can lead to promotions and salary increases.
